随着数字化转型的推进,企业对服务器租用的需求日益增加。在选择服务器租用方案时,除了性能和成本外,高可用性和容错能力成为评估的重要指标。本文将讨论如何通过合理的架构设计和技术手段,提升租用服务器的稳定性和可靠性,以应对各种潜在的故障和挑战。
设计高可用性架构
在服务器租用环境中实现高可用性的关键在于设计具备冗余和备份的架构:
- 多服务器负载均衡:通过负载均衡技术将流量分散到多台服务器,防止单点故障,并提升系统的整体性能和稳定性。
- 高可用性数据库:采用主从复制或集群配置的数据库系统,确保数据的持久性和可靠性,即使在部分服务器故障时仍能保持服务的连续性。
- 灾备数据中心:选择具备灾备能力的数据中心,实现跨数据中心的备份和应急恢复,提供更高级别的容错保障。
实施容错能力策略
为应对不可预见的故障和突发事件,服务器租用需要实施有效的容错能力策略:
- 定期备份和恢复测试:建立定期备份计划,并通过恢复测试验证备份数据的完整性和可用性,以确保在数据丢失或损坏时能够快速恢复服务。
- 监控和警报系统:部署实时监控和警报系统,监测服务器健康状态、性能指标和网络流量,及时发现并响应潜在的故障或异常情况。
- 自动化运维和故障转移:利用自动化工具和脚本实现快速的故障检测和服务转移,减少人为操作的延迟和错误可能性。
应对技术挑战和未来展望
在服务器租用环境中实现高可用性和容错能力面临诸多挑战,包括网络安全、数据隐私保护和资源利用效率等:
- 网络安全与数据隐私:加强服务器和网络设施的安全性措施,保护敏感数据免遭恶意攻击或非法访问。
- 资源优化与性能提升:优化服务器资源配置和利用效率,通过性能调优和负载均衡技术提升服务的响应速度和处理能力。
- 新技术的应用与探索:积极采纳新兴技术,如容器化和服务器无状态架构,以应对日益复杂和多样化的业务需求。
结论
通过以上策略和技术手段,企业可以在选择和使用服务器租用服务时,更好地保障业务的连续性和稳定性。未来,随着技术的不断发展和应用场景的拓展,服务器租用将继续扮演关键角色,为企业提供灵活、可靠的IT基础设施支持,促进业务的创新和增长。